A brilliant opportunity has arisen for one of our well established clients based in the west midlands that operate as market leaders in mobile mapping and Geomatic surveying. They focus on larger scale projects using the latest digital technology. Their mission is to deliver a professional and personal service, regulated at all times by RICS controls and underpinned by strong ethical standards.
Due to a large influx of work they are now looking for Land Surveyors at a range of experience levels to join the team. As the land surveyor your role will involve supporting Senior Surveyors and Project Managers to conduct surveys in a variety of different environments. The types of survey tasks you will carry out include; topographic, utility, mobile mapping, laser scanning and office data processing. The sectors in which they specialise are; rail and guided transport, highways and bridges, aviation and airside, estates and property, energy & utilities and environmental & marine.

Veterans in Robotics: A Military‑to‑Civilian Pathway into Autonomous‑Systems Careers

Introduction From bomb‑disposal droids rolling through Basra to AI‑driven picking arms inside Ocado warehouses, robotics has already transformed how we fight wars and fill shopping baskets. The UK Government’s Robotics & Autonomous Systems (RAS) Roadmap 2030 predicts £100 billion in annual economic impact and 260,000 new jobs by the end of the decade. The Ministry of Defence (MoD) mirrors this growth with programmes such as Project Theseus (autonomous last‑mile resupply) and NavyX Autonomy Accelerator. Veterans—battle‑tested in remote‑handling, mission planning, and safety protocols—have precisely the mindset employers need. Whether you piloted EOD robots, maintained UAVs, or orchestrated logistic convoys, you already think in joints, sensors, and control loops.
